body {background-color: #FFFFFF; margin: 0px; padding: 0px; background-image: url(/i/sportindex/page_bg.jpg);}
#all {visibility: visible; padding: 0px; border-width: 0px; border-style: none; margin: 0px; position: relative; top: 0px; z-index: 1;}
#toptabs {position:absolute; left: 140px; top: 120px; width: 372px; height:17; z-index: 1;}
#topstorymain {position:absolute; left: 140px; top: 120px; width: 372px; height:440; z-index: 1;}
#content {width: 367px; padding: 4px 0px 8px 8px; z-index: 1}
#floatframe {position:absolute; left: 140px; top: 120px; width: 372px; height:440; z-index: 1;}
#rolloutMORE {display: none; background-color: #636363; width: 140px; padding: 3px 7px 3px 7px; z-index: 1000;}
#rolloutNATION {display: none; background-color: #636363; width: 140px; padding: 3px 7px 3px 7px; z-index: 1000;}
#rolloutMALL {display: none; background-color: #636363; width: 140px; padding: 3px 7px 3px 7px; z-index: 1000;}
#rolloutPERSON {display: none; background-color: #636363; width: 140px; padding: 3px 7px 3px 7px; z-index: 1000;}
#rolloutESPN {display: none; background-color: #636363; width: 140px; padding: 3px 7px 3px 7px; z-index: 1000;}
#nav {position: absolute; top: 130px; left: 0px; background-color: #7d7d7d; width: 139px; padding: 0px; z-index: 2;}
#right {position: absolute; top: 0px; left: 512px; width: 260px; padding: 0px; z-index: 2;}
#tab {width: 260px; padding: 0px; z-index: 5;}

#center {position:absolute; left: 140px; top: 560px; width: 372px; z-index: 1;}
#headlines {padding: 0px; background-image: url(/i/sportindex/headlines_bg.jpg); width:260px; height:200px; overflow:hidden; border-bottom: 1px solid #000000;}
#headlines_search {padding: 0px; background-image: url(/i/fp/tabs/bg_grey_lt.gif); width:260px; height:245px; overflow:hidden; border-bottom: 1px solid #000000;}

#msn_header {width: 772px; height: 63px; background-color: #686B6E; overflow: hidden}
#msn_header a:link { color:#FFFFFF; text-decoration:none; font-weight: bold}
#msn_header a:hover { color:#FFFFCC; text-decoration:underline; font-weight: bold}
#msn_header a:visited { color:#FFFFFF; text-decoration: none; font-weight: bold}
#msn_header a:visited:hover { color:#FFFFCC; text-decoration: underline; font-weight: bold}

#msn_footer {width: 772px; height: 102px; position: absolute; visibility:hidden; left:0px; z-index: 500; margin-bottom: -15px; background-color: #686B6E; overflow: hidden}
#msn_footer a:link { color:#FFFFFF; text-decoration:none; font-weight: bold}
#msn_footer a:hover { color:#FFFFFF; text-decoration:underline; font-weight: bold}
#msn_footer a:visited { color:#FFFFFF; text-decoration: none; font-weight: bold}
#msn_footer a:visited:hover { color:#FFFFFF; text-decoration: underline; font-weight: bold}

#msn_sidebar {width: 160px; background-color: #686B6E; position: absolute; left: 772px; top: 0px; overflow-x:hidden}

#nowinmotion {width: 260px;background-image: url(/i/fp/rightcolpromo_bg.gif);color: #FFFFFF;font-family: Verdana, Arial;font-size: 10px;}
#nowinmotion a:link, #nowinmotion a:visited {color: #FFFFFF;font-family: Verdana, Arial;font-size: 10px;font-weight: bold;}
.nowinmotionheadline {padding: 5px; font-family: Verdana, Arial;font-size: 10pt; font-weight:bold; margin-left: -5px;}
.nowinmotionheadline2 {padding: 5px; font-family: Verdana, Arial;font-size: 10pt; font-weight:bold; margin-left: 25px;}

#headlines2 {padding: 0px; background-image: url(/i/sportindex/headlines2_bg.gif); width:260px; height:200px; overflow:hidden;}

.headlinks2 {font: 10px Arial, sans-serif; color: #2b3667; padding: 0px 5px 5px 11px; line-height:13px;}
.headlinks2 A:link {color: #2b3667; text-decoration: none;}
.headlinks2 A:visited {color: #656565; text-decoration: none;}
.headlinks2 A:hover {color: #2b3667; text-decoration: underline;}
.headlinks2 A:visited:hover {color: #656565; text-decoration: underline;}

#recentsearches {background-image: url(/i/fp/tabs/bg_grey_lt.gif);width: 100%;border-bottom: 0px solid #000000;float:left;}	
#rs2 {padding: 2px 6px 6px 12px;margin-left: 0px;font-family: Verdana, sans-serif;font-size: 11px;line-height:18px;color: #666;float:left;}
#rs2 strong{font-family: Verdana, sans-serif;font-size: 11px;color: #000;}
#rs2 a{color: #2b3667;text-decoration: none;}
#rs2 a:visited{color: #656565;text-decoration: none;}
#rs2 a:hover{color: #2b3667;text-decoration: underline;}
#rs2 a:visited{color: #656565;text-decoration: none;}
#rs2 img{margin-right: 6px;}

#hnews a{color: #000;text-decoration: none;}
#hnews a:visited{color: #333;text-decoration: none;}
#hnews a:hover{color: #f00;text-decoration: underline;}
#hnews a:hover:visted{color: #666;text-decoration: none;}
#hnews {padding: 0px 0px 0px 12px;float:left;font-family: Verdana, sans-serif;font-size: 11px;font-weight: bold;line-height:18px;}

#rssfeed a:link{color: #336;text-decoration: none;}
#rssfeed a:visited{color: #333;text-decoration: none;}
#rssfeed a:hover{color: #f00;text-decoration: underline;}
#rssfeed a:hover:visted{color: #666;text-decoration: none;}
#rssfeed {float: right; margin-right: 5px; font-family: Verdana, sans-serif;font-size: 11px;font-weight: bold;}
#rssfeed {float: right; margin-right: 5px; margin-top: 2px; font-family: Verdana, sans-serif;font-size: 11px;font-weight: bold;}

.news_rss {float: left; width: 99%;}

.smalllead	{line-height: 10px;}
.caption {font: 10px Verdana, Arial, sans-serif; color: #7f7b7d; font-weight: bold;}

.copy {font: 11px Verdana, Arial, sans-serif; color: #000000; line-height:15px;}
.copy a:link {color: #00009B;}
.copy a:visited {color: #6A644C;}
.copy a:hover {color: #951515;}

.n {font: 10px Verdana, Arial, sans-serif; color: #edc508; font-weight: bold; background-color: #7d7d7d; padding: 3px;}
.n A {text-decoration: none; color: #edc508;}
.n A:hover {text-decoration: none; color: #e5e5e5;}

.scores {font: 10px Verdana, Arial, sans-serif; color: #ffffff; font-weight: bold; background-color: #7d7d7d; padding: 2px 0px 0px 10px;}
.scores A {text-decoration: none; color: #ffffff;}
.scores A:hover {text-decoration: none; color: #e5e5e5;}

.n2 {font: 10px Verdana, Arial, sans-serif; color: #dedfbd; font-weight: bold; background-color: #7d7d7d; padding: 3px; background-image: url(/i/sportindex/mbg.gif);}
.n2 A {text-decoration: none; color: #dedfbd;}
.n2 A:hover {text-decoration: none; color: #e5e5e5;}

.n3 {font: 10px Verdana, Arial, sans-serif; color: #dedfbd; font-weight: bold; background-color: #636363; padding: 2px;}
.n3 A {text-decoration: none; color: #dedfbd;}
.n3 A:hover {text-decoration: none; color: #e5e5e5;}

.n4 {font: 10px Verdana, Arial, sans-serif; color: #dedfbd; font-weight: bold; background-color: #7d7d7d; padding: 2px 2px 2px 6px;}
.n4 A {text-decoration: none; color: #dedfbd;}
.n4 A:hover {text-decoration: none; color: #ffffff;}

.n5 {font: 10px Verdana, Arial, sans-serif; color: #636363; font-weight: bold; background-color: #cccccc; padding: 2px 2px 2px 6px;}
.n5 A {text-decoration: none; color: #636363;}
.n5 A:hover {text-decoration: none; color: #7d7d7d;}

.navdivider {background-color: #636363;	font-size: 1px; height: 1px; overflow-y: hidden; line-height: 1px;}

.blank {background-color: #636363; height: 1px; width:139 px; padding: 0px;}

.padding {padding: 12px 12px 0px 12px;}

.roll {font: 10px Verdana, Arial, sans-serif; color: #edc508; font-weight: bold; background-color: #636363; line-height:15px;}
.roll A {text-decoration: none; color: #edc508;}
.roll A:hover {text-decoration: none; color: #e5e5e5;}

.v {color: #000000; font-size: 10px; font-family: Verdana, Arial, Helvetica, Geneva, sans-serif; style:inline; padding: 1px; border: 1px; border-style:solid; border-color:#000000;}
.v A {color: #000000;}

.columnists {padding: 0px; width:162px; overflow: hidden;}

.boxline {border: 1px #adadad solid; padding: 0px;}

.column {font: 10px Verdana, Arial, sans-serif; color: #000000; padding: 3px; z-index: 1;}
.column A {color: #00009b;}
.column A:hover {color: #951515;}

.copy {font: 11px Verdana, Arial, sans-serif; color: #000000; line-height:15px;}
.copy a:link {color: #00009B;}
.copy a:visited {color: #6A644C;}
.copy a:hover {color: #951515;}
 
.medium {font: 11px Arial, sans-serif; color: #000000; line-height:13px; padding-bottom:8px;}
.medium A {color: #00009b;}
.medium A:hover {color: #951515;}

.small {font: 10px Verdana, Arial, sans-serif; color: #000000; line-height:11px; padding-bottom:8px;}
.small A {color: #00009b;}
.small A:hover {color: #951515;}

.smallw {font: 10px Verdana, Arial, sans-serif; color: #ffffff; line-height:11px; padding-bottom:8px;}
.smallw A {color: #ffffff;}
.smallw A:hover {color: #adadad;}

.footer {font: 10px  Verdana, Arial, sans-serif; color: #7c7e7c; line-height:13px;}
.footer A {color: #7c7e7c;}
.footer A:hover {color: #7c7e7c;}

.bullet {font: 11px Arial, sans-serif; color: #000000; line-height:16px;}
.bullet a:link {color: #00009B;}
.bullet a:visited {color: #6A644C;}
.bullet a:hover {color: #951515;}

.twinbreaking {font: 11px Verdana, Arial, sans-serif; color: #000000; padding: 0px 5px 5px 15px; line-height:15px; background-color: #ffffff; background-image: url(/i/sportindex/twin_breaking.jpg);}
.twinbreaking A {color: #00009b;}
.twinbreaking A:hover {color: #951515;}

.twinmore {font: 11px Verdana, Arial, sans-serif; color: #000000; padding: 0px 5px 5px 15px; line-height:15px; background-color: #ffffff; background-image: url(/i/sportindex/twin_more.jpg);}
.twinmore A {color: #00009b;}
.twinmore A:hover {color: #951515;}

.twinwhitebg {font: 11px Verdana, Arial, sans-serif; color: #000000; padding: 0px 5px 5px 15px; line-height:15px; background-color: #ffffff; background-image: url(/i/sportindex/white_bg.jpg);}
.twinwhitebg  A {color: #00009b;}
.twinwhitebg  A:hover {color: #951515;}

.twinbullet {font: 10px Verdana, sans-serif; color: #000000; line-height:16px; font-weight: bold;}
.twinbullet A {color: #00009b;}
.twinbullet A:hover {color: #951515;}

.twinhead {font: 13px Arial, Verdana, sans-serif; color: #000000; padding: 0px; line-height:15px;; border: 0px #000000 solid; font-weight: bold}
.twinhead A {color: #000000;}

.twinsub {font: 16px Arial, sans-serif; color: #ffffff; font-weight: bold; line-height:25px;}
.twinsub A {color: #ffffff;}
.twinsub A:hover {color: #ffffff;}

.headlinks {font: 11px Arial, sans-serif; color: #2b3667; padding: 0px 5px 5px 11px; line-height:18px;}
.headlinks A:link {color: #2b3667; text-decoration: none;}
.headlinks A:visited {color: #656565; text-decoration: none;}
.headlinks A:hover {color: #2b3667; text-decoration: underline;}
.headlinks A:visited:hover {color: #656565; text-decoration: underline;}

.subhead {font: 16px Arial, sans-serif; color: #aa0b09; font-weight: bold; line-height:25px;}
.subhead A {color: #aa0b09;}
.subhead A:hover {color: #951515;}

.chatter {font: 12px Arial, sans-serif; color: #000000; font-weight: bold; line-height:15px;}
.chatter A {color: #aa0b09;}
.chatter A:hover {color: #951515;}

.net {font: 10px Verdana, Arial, sans-serif; color: #ffffff; font-weight: bold; background-color: #000000; width:772px; height:18px; padding: 0px;}
.net A {text-decoration: none; color: #ffffff;}
.net A:hover {text-decoration: none; color: #e5e5e5;}

.gt {font: 10px Verdana, Arial, sans-serif; color: #b3b3b3; background-color: #808080; padding: 0px; height:20px;}
.gt A {text-decoration: none;}
.gt A:hover {text-decoration: none; color: #e5e5e5;}

.apartner	{font-family: verdana, arial, san-serif; font-size: 10px; color: #a50400; font-weight: bold; padding: 0px 0px 8px 0px;}

.boxform {font: 10px verdana, arial, sans-serif; color: #636163; text-decoration: none; text-indent: 8; background-color: #cecfce;}
.boxform A {text-decoration: none; color: #ffffff;}
.boxform A:link {text-decoration: none; color: #ffffff;}
.boxform A:visited {text-decoration: none; color: #ffffff;}
.boxform A:hover {text-decoration: none; color: #cc0000;}

.scores {font: 10px Verdana, Arial, sans-serif; color: #ffffff; font-weight: bold; background-color: #7d7d7d; padding: 2px 0px 0px 10px;}
.scores A {text-decoration: none; color: #ffffff;}
.scores A:hover {text-decoration: none; color: #e5e5e5;}

.radio {font: 10px Verdana, Arial, sans-serif; color: #000000; font-weight: bold; padding: 2px 0px 2px 4px;}
.radio A:LINK	{color: #AE3234;}
.radio A:HOVER	{color: #AE3234;}
.radio A:VISITED {color: #AE3234;}

.fantasy {font: 10px  Arial, sans-serif; color: #000000; line-height: 9px;}
.fantasy A:LINK	{color: #333333; line-height: 120%;}
.fantasy A:HOVER	{color: #a50400;}
.fantasy A:VISITED {color: #333333;}

.stats {font: 10px  Arial, sans-serif; color: #000000; line-height: 9px; font-weight: bold; padding: 0px 0px 0px 0px;}
.stats A:LINK	{color: #AE3234;}
.stats A:HOVER	{color: #333333;}
.stats A:VISITED	{color: #333333;}

.statshead {font: 9px  verdana, Arial, sans-serif; color: #ffffff; line-height: 9px; font-weight: bold; padding: 0px 0px 0px 0px;}
.statshead A:LINK	{color: #e77977;}
.statshead A:HOVER	{color: #ffffff;}
.statshead A:VISITED	{color: #e77977;}

.onairlite {font: 10px Verdana, Arial, sans-serif; color: #000000; font-weight: bold; background-image: url(/i/sportindex/onairlite_bg.gif);background-color: #D5D5D5; padding: 2px 0px 2px 4px;}
.onairdark {font: 10px Verdana, Arial, sans-serif; color: #000000; font-weight: bold; padding: 2px 0px 2px 4px;}
.onairtime {font: 10px Verdana, Arial, sans-serif; color: #000000; padding: 2px 4px 2px 0px;}

.tabpadding {padding: 10px 10px 10px 12px;}

.tabspacer {font-size: 1px;	height: 10px;}

#columnistsTab {
	width: 260px;
	height: 125px;
	overflow: hidden;
}

#scoresTab {
	width: 260px;
	height: 152px;
	overflow: hidden;
}

#tab_statistics {
	overflow: hidden;
	width: 260px;
	height: 132px;
	background-color: #808080;
	font-family: Verdana, Arial;
	font-weight: bold;
	font-size: 10px;
	color: #ffffff;
	background-image:url(/i/mlb/fantasytab_bg.gif);
	line-height: 120%;
}

#tab_fantasy {
	overflow: hidden;
	width: 260px;
	height: 132px;
	background-color: #808080;
	font-family: Verdana, Arial;
	font-size: 10px;
	color: #000000;
	background-image:url(/i/mlb/fantasytab_bg.gif);
	line-height: 120%;
}

#tab_scores {
	overflow: hidden;
	width: 260px;
	height: 132px;
	background-color: #808080;
	background-image:url(/i/mlb/scorestab_bg.gif);
}

#tab_fantasy a:link, #tab_statistics a:link {text-decoration: underline; color: #000000;}
#tab_fantasy a:visited, #tab_statistics a:visited {text-decoration: underline; color: #000000;}
#tab_fantasy a:hover, #tab_statistics a:hover {text-decoration: underline; color: #E6D897;}
